Total number of apples in storage on May 1 was 6.2% more than 2021

The U.S. Apple Association has released its May 2022 USAppleTracker.

According to the survey, the total number of apples in storage on May 1, 2022, was 58.2 million bushels, 6.2% more than last May’s total of 54.8 million bushels and 0.1% more than the 5-year average for that date.

Fresh apple holdings this May, totaled 41.2 million bushels, 8.5% more than the inventories reported for last May. Processing holdings totaled 17 million bushels, 1% more than last year on May 1.

Christopher Gerlach, USApple’s director of industry analytics said this report captures more than 95% of the national storage capacity.
